What companies run services between Wolverhampton, England and Erasmus Darwin House, England?

You can take a train from Wolverhampton to Erasmus Darwin House via Birmingham New Street and Lichfield City in around 1h 27m. Alternatively, you can take a bus from Wolverhampton Bus Station to Erasmus Darwin House via Walsall Bus Station and Old Library in around 1h 45m.
